Steps to Complete the Minnesota Trailer Registration Online

To fill out the Minnesota trailer registration online form, follow these steps:

  1. Visit the Minnesota Department of Public Safety website.
  2. Locate the section for trailer registration and select the option for online registration.
  3. Provide necessary vehicle details, including the trailer's make, model, and Vehicle Identification Number (VIN).
  4. Enter your personal information, such as your driver's license number and contact details.
  5. Input your insurance information, including the policy number and expiration date.
  6. Review all entered information for accuracy before submission.
  7. Submit the form and pay any required fees through the online payment system.

Each of these steps is crucial to ensure that your registration is processed without delays. Make sure to have all required documents ready before starting the online process.

Required Documents for Minnesota Trailer Registration Online

When registering a trailer online in Minnesota, certain documents are necessary to complete the process successfully. These documents include:

  • Proof of Ownership: This can be a bill of sale or previous registration documents.
  • Identification: A valid Minnesota driver's license or state ID is required.
  • Insurance Information: Details about your insurance policy, including the company name and policy number.
  • Payment Method: A credit or debit card is necessary to pay the registration fees online.

Having these documents ready will facilitate a smooth registration experience and help avoid any potential issues during the submission process.

State-Specific Rules for the Minnesota Trailer Registration Online

Each state has its own regulations regarding trailer registration, and Minnesota is no exception. Key state-specific rules include:

  • Registration Fees: Fees vary based on the trailer's weight and type. Users should be aware of these fees before starting the registration process.
  • Renewal Periods: Trailers must be renewed annually, and users should keep track of their renewal dates to avoid penalties.
  • Homemade Trailers: Special rules apply to homemade trailers, including specific documentation requirements for registration.

Understanding these state-specific rules is essential for ensuring compliance and avoiding complications during the registration process.
